Even to the very end, Track Night in America remains the fastest way for nearly anyone to get on a real racing circuit. Participants only need be at least 18 years old with a valid driver’s license, have access to a helmet and street car in good working condition, and possess a willingness to have an adventure. You don’t need to be an SCCA member to join in the fun, and no previous on-track experience is required.

The cost is never more than $150 per event, which gets folks three 20-minute sessions on track. Entrants are divided into Novice, Intermediate or Advanced groups so on-track time remains fun for everyone. And as usual, admission is free for those wishing to just hang out and enjoy the festivities or display cherished rides.
